The terms C-band and “Mid-band” are often used interchangeably . It is more accurate to describe the C-band frequency range as a component of the larger 3.3 – 4.2 GHz mid-band spectrum.

C-band refers to the portion of the electromagnetic spectrum allotted for satellite transmissions in the 4GHz to 8GHz frequency range. C-band satellite antennas are used frequently in areas of the world where signals can become degraded due to heavy rain or other intense climate-related conditions.

Verizon’s C-band network showed decent range in testing in a dense part of Queens, NY. Cell distance is a tricky thing. This paper from 2006 estimates that 3.5GHz networks can go up to 1.2 miles from each site in an urban area and up to 6.2 miles in a rural area .
